Pronunciation
*"Cab-er-nay Saw-vin-yawn"*
Style
Full - Bodied Red Wine
Description
"The world’s most popular red wine grape is a natural cross between Cabernet Franc and Sauvignon Blanc from Bordeaux, France. Cabernet Sauvignon is loved for its black fruit flavours, high concentration and age worthiness. The rich flavor and high tannin content in Cabernet Sauvignon make it a perfect partner to rich grilled meats, peppery sauces, and dishes with high flavor. Each growing region typically has it's own intrepretation of this impressive wine."

Notes
Black Cherry, Black Currant, Bell Pepper, Baking Spice, Oak
